## Formula sandbox tuning

User-supplied formulas in Gridmoor execute inside a restricted interpreter with hard ceilings on time, memory, and call depth. Reviewers should confirm any change to these ceilings is justified in the PR description, since raising them widens the abuse surface. Defaults were chosen from production traces. The current limits are as follows.

limits module of tafog-fawip:
WEIGHTS = {
    "julix": 57,
    "lamys": 992,
    "kasvan": 209,
    "quenok": 750,
    "alddor": 259,
    "oliath": 1009,
    "wenix": 815,
}

Thanks for the patch to Larkspur's config watcher — the debounce logic looks right, but please note that external plugins observe reloads asynchronously, so a plugin may briefly see the old snapshot after the file changes. Document that window clearly, and make sure your plugin re-reads derived values rather than caching them at load time. The reload cadence and grace periods are governed by the following tuning constants.

constants for tafog-kahag:
RATE_LIMITS = {
    "sorir": 697,
    "oliox": 683,
    "holax": 176,
    "casox": 60,
    "pelius": 382,
}

## Changelog — Pulseward health checks

Defaults changed behind the Kestrel load balancer. Interval tightened from 30s to 10s, failure threshold lowered to 2, and the probe path now hits the shallow endpoint instead of the deep dependency check. Slow-start weighting is enabled by default on new targets. One node flapped during rollout; resolved after cache warm-up. No action needed unless eviction alerts fire. Current defaults as deployed are listed below.

service settings:
PRAIX_LOG_LEVEL=error
PRAIX_METRICS_HOST=metrics.praix.qorvelcorp.corp
PRAIX_POOL_SIZE=16